About:
uxdstools is a set of Unix directory service tools. It is a suite of command tools to administer POSIX user and group accounts in an LDAP directory. It is similar in spirit to the useradd/mod/del tools found on Linux and Solaris, the pw tools on BSD, the mk|ch|rmuser/group tools on AIX, etc. However, instead of manipulating local accounts, uxdstools manages POSIX-type accounts that can be found in LDAP directory services installations, namely those with posixAccount and posixGroup attributes.

Changes:
memberUids can now be added and deleted from group
accounts with lgroupmod. Man pages were created
for each executable. Password options (-p/-P) now
work with -c when GSSAPI is enabled. The creds
cache will be placed where the -c argument input
specifies. Upon primary group membership change,
the gidNumber is updated in the user account to
reflect the change.
